Marcel Bénabou is a scholar of Roman history, a novelist, and, since 1970, the Definitively Provisional Secretary of the Oulipo. His first and latest books are Résistance africaine à la romanisation (1976) and Ecrire sur Tamara (2002). Three of his novels have been published in English by the University of Nebraska Press:  Why I Have Not Written Any of My Books (1996), Dump This Book While You Still Can! (2001),  and, winner of the National Jewish Book Award, Jacob, Menahem, and Mimoun: A Family Epic (1998).
